Interactive Birthday Gifts for Adults
Interactive birthday gifts for adults bring more to the celebration than a wrapped object waiting on a shelf. They invite the recipient to make, solve, taste, play, learn or share something with other people, which makes them especially memorable for birthdays that call for an experience rather than another conventional keepsake. The right choice can turn an ordinary evening into a lively gathering: a cooperative puzzle can draw everyone around the coffee table, a hands-on food-making kit can give friends a reason to linger in the kitchen, and a game built around clues or predictions can keep conversation moving long after dinner is served. These gifts also work well for adults with different interests, schedules and living arrangements. Some are designed for one person who enjoys a daily challenge, while others are best opened at a dinner party, game night or relaxed weekend get-together. When choosing among interactive birthday gifts for adults, consider how the recipient likes to spend free time, whether they prefer a structured activity or room for improvisation, and how many people are likely to join. A tech-connected puzzle or brain teaser may appeal to someone who enjoys tracking progress, learning new techniques and trying to improve a personal best. An app may offer timed challenges, tutorials or helpful prompts, giving the activity a sense of momentum without requiring a large commitment. For someone who enjoys small rituals, an interactive mug or similar everyday item with scannable daily content can add a fresh prompt, piece of trivia, reflection or moment of mindfulness to a morning coffee or afternoon tea. These options are easy to use at home and can suit a wide range of ages, making them thoughtful choices for a sibling, friend, coworker or partner. Look for clear instructions, a straightforward setup and a format that feels inviting rather than intimidating. An engaging gift should make it easy to begin, whether that means opening a box after a birthday meal, downloading an accompanying app or setting aside a few minutes with a favorite drink.
Shared activities are often particularly fitting for adult birthdays because they create a story everyone can remember. Party and sports-themed card games can add friendly competition to a gathering, with quick rounds that fit naturally between snacks, conversation and the main event. Cooperative formats are useful when the goal is to bring a group together rather than crown a single winner, while prediction-based games can give guests an easy way to participate even if they do not know every rule or follow every sport closely. At-home mystery kits offer another lively option, transforming a dining room into the setting for a playful whodunit. Guests can read clues, take on characters and compare theories as the evening unfolds; the experience feels special without requiring a restaurant reservation or elaborate travel plans. These gifts are well suited to hosts who enjoy planning themed dinners, costume parties or celebrations with a little theatrical energy. For a smaller group, DIY maker kits provide a satisfying hands-on activity that can be completed at an unhurried pace. Food-focused kits may guide the recipient through making items such as hot sauce, fresh cheese or crafted cocktails, combining practical instruction with the pleasure of enjoying the finished result. They can be a natural fit for a curious home cook, an enthusiastic host or anyone who likes understanding how ingredients come together. Before purchasing, check the expected preparation time, included components, necessary tools and storage requirements. Some activities are best completed in one sitting, while others call for refrigeration, advance preparation or a well-stocked kitchen. It is also worth considering dietary needs, alcohol preferences and comfort with messier projects. A gift that matches the recipient’s habits will feel generous and personal; a kit that requires equipment they do not own or ingredients they rarely use may be less enjoyable. During the warmer part of the year, these activities can move easily between a kitchen and an outdoor table, while during cooler months they offer a welcoming way to gather indoors around a shared project.
Classes and flexible experience gifts give the birthday recipient an opportunity to choose how they want to celebrate. A virtual or local class can introduce new skills in cooking, baking, pottery, ceramics or another creative discipline, with the added benefit of guidance from an instructor. A cooking class, for example, can be both a present and a plan: ingredients are gathered, techniques are demonstrated and the recipient leaves with something they helped create. In-person formats suit people who enjoy meeting others and learning in a dedicated setting, while virtual classes can be a practical choice for long-distance gifting, busy schedules or a birthday shared across different homes. Open-ended experience vouchers offer similar flexibility when the recipient has a full calendar or very specific interests. Depending on the available options, they may choose a spa visit, an outdoor adventure, a gourmet food tour, a race-related activity or another memorable outing. Flexible gifts are especially useful for partners, close friends and family members who value time together as much as the activity itself; a birthday experience can become a day of exploring a neighborhood, sharing a meal or trying something neither person has done before. For more inspiration, explore Birthday Experience Gifts For Partners. As with any experience-based present, review redemption details, booking windows, location requirements, accessibility information and cancellation policies before purchasing. Think about whether the recipient prefers a quiet creative afternoon, an energetic group activity or a carefully planned occasion with room to choose. Interactive birthday gifts for adults are at their best when they reflect that preference and make participation feel natural. Whether the result is a solved puzzle, a shared laugh over an unexpected clue, a new kitchen skill or a future date marked on the calendar, these gifts offer something lasting: an experience that becomes part of the birthday memory rather than ending when the wrapping paper is cleared away.
